Newshour - French fight in Mali town - 麻豆官网首页入口 Sounds

Newshour - French fight in Mali town - 麻豆官网首页入口 Sounds


French fight in Mali town

French troops fight militias in Mali streets; Iraq bombs target Kurds; horsemeat recipes

Coming Up Next